58.  Kingdom Hearts 2- Fighting Sephiroth.

This guy has a lot of moves which will make your head spin, and can kill you before you can say “Mickey Mouse”. Sephiroth moves about the battle ground with impressive speed, and occasionally teleports. He can also activate his attack “Stigma” which summons gigantic pillars of flames that can suck matter in, orbs of darkness called “Shadow Flares” and his most powerful attack “Super Nova” where he calls down meteors that spin around him and then explode. He can also kill you with one combo, no matter how high your level is. The best thing to do? Always be prepared.
